def configure_cache_region(region): """Configure a cache region. :param region: optional CacheRegion object, if not provided a new region will be instantiated :raises: exception.ValidationError :returns: dogpile.cache.CacheRegion """ if not isinstance(region, dogpile.cache.CacheRegion): raise exception.ValidationError( _('region not type dogpile.cache.CacheRegion')) if 'backend' not in region.__dict__: # NOTE(morganfainberg): this is how you tell if a region is configured. # There is a request logged with dogpile.cache upstream to make this # easier / less ugly. config_dict = build_cache_config() region.configure_from_config(config_dict, '%s.' % CONF.cache.config_prefix) if CONF.cache.debug_cache_backend: region.wrap(DebugProxy) # NOTE(morganfainberg): if the backend requests the use of a # key_mangler, we should respect that key_mangler function. If a # key_mangler is not defined by the backend, use the sha1_mangle_key # mangler provided by dogpile.cache. This ensures we always use a fixed # size cache-key. This is toggle-able for debug purposes; if disabled # this could cause issues with certain backends (such as memcached) and # its limited key-size. if region.key_mangler is None: if CONF.cache.use_key_mangler: region.key_mangler = util.sha1_mangle_key for class_path in CONF.cache.proxies: # NOTE(morganfainberg): if we have any proxy wrappers, we should # ensure they are added to the cache region's backend. Since # configure_from_config doesn't handle the wrap argument, we need # to manually add the Proxies. For information on how the # ProxyBackends work, see the dogpile.cache documents on # "changing-backend-behavior" cls = importutils.import_class(class_path) LOG.debug(_('Adding cache-proxy \'%s\' to backend.') % class_path) region.wrap(cls) return region
